PostgreSQL ট্রিগার এবং সঞ্চিত পদ্ধতিগুলির জন্য আপনি কোন ভাষা ব্যবহার করেন?

PostgreSQL আকর্ষণীয় যে এটি সঞ্চিত পদ্ধতি লেখার জন্য বেশ কয়েকটি ভাষা সমর্থন করে। কোনটি আপনি ব্যবহার করেন, এবং কেন?

0
এটি বিভিন্ন ভাষায় খালি ট্রিগারগুলির একটি পারফর্মেন্স পরীক্ষা: openscg.com / 2014/05 / ট্রিগার-ওভারহেড-অংশ-2
যোগ লেখক bartolo-otrit, উৎস

7 উত্তর

যখন আমি আমার প্রথম ট্রিগারটি লিখেছিলাম তখন এটি পার্লে ছিল কারণ এই ভাষাটি আমি উদাহরণে ব্যবহার করেছি কিন্তু পাইথনে কোথায় আমি লিখেছিলাম যে আমি এটিকে আরো আরামদায়ক বলে মনে করি।

আমি মনে করি প্রোগ্রামার সান্ত্বনা পাইথন নির্বাচন করার আমার প্রধান কারণ কিন্তু আমি মনে করি পার্ল এখনও ভাল সমর্থিত।

0
যোগ

আমি শুধুমাত্র পিএল / পি জি এসকিউএল ব্যবহার করেছি, কিন্তু এটি ছিল কারণ আমি কয়েকটি সংরক্ষিত পদ্ধতির তুলনায় অপেক্ষাকৃত দ্রুত এবং সার্ভারে অতিরিক্ত মডিউল যোগ করতে চাইনি।

দীর্ঘ মেয়াদে, আমি সম্ভবত পিএল / পার্ল বা পিএল / পাইথন ব্যবহার করবো, আমি দ্রুত স্ক্রিপ্টিংয়ের জন্য পার্ল ব্যবহার করি এবং এখন পাইথনকে কিছু সময়ের জন্য দেখছি।

আমি যে জিনিস পেয়েছি তা হল যে PostgreSQL সাইটে এটির জন্য ভাল ডকুমেন্টেশনের অভাব আছে। ম্যানুয়েলগুলি একটি রেফারেন্স হিসাবে পুঙ্খানুপুঙ্খ ছিল, কিন্তু মানুষকে কিভাবে এটি করা উচিত তা প্রদর্শন করতে সহায়তা করার জন্য এটি একটি টিউটোরিয়াল হিসাবে ভালভাবে কাজ করে নি।

যে, খুব ভাল ডিবাগিং পরিবেশের সাথে সংযুক্ত, এর মানে হল যে লেখার প্রথম অভিজ্ঞতা আমার দীর্ঘ সময়ের জন্য অদ্ভুত সিনট্যাক্স ত্রুটির দিকে নজর রেখেছে।

যদি কেউ PostgreSQL প্রোগ্রামিং এর জন্য টিউটোরিয়াল সহ একটি ভাল সাইট সম্পর্কে জানেন, আমি এটি একটি লিঙ্ক পেতে ভালোবাসি।

0
যোগ

সত্যিই কিছু ছোট / সহজ জন্য বা যে স্ট্রিং ম্যানিপুলেশন বা যুক্তিবিজ্ঞান অনেক প্রয়োজন হয় না, আমি plpgsql ব্যবহার, এটি দ্রুত কারণ। আরো জটিল বিষয়গুলির জন্য, আমি প্লপারকে ব্যবহার করি, কারণ আমি এটি পছন্দ করি।

0
যোগ

স্কাইপ প্যাথন সহ PostgreSQL ব্যবহার করে, এবং এটিকে বর্তমান অবস্থাতে PL / Python- এর উন্নতি হয়েছে তাই আমি পাইথন সাপোর্ট পেলে অনেক পিছিয়ে থাকব। তারা যারা বাইন্ডিং উপরে সারি / প্রতিলিপি সিস্টেম লিখিত আছে, সব পরে :-)

Take a look: Wiki Skytools

ডকুমেন্টেশনে দ্রুত বর্ণ থেকে, পাইথন কম দেখায়   প্রিলে বাইন্ডিংয়ের চেয়ে ডকুমেন্টেশন, কিন্তু আমি শুধু স্টিক করার পরামর্শ দিচ্ছি   ভাষা আপনি সঙ্গে সবচেয়ে আরামদায়ক সঙ্গে।

0
যোগ

আমি plpgsql মধ্যে বেশ কিছু সবকিছু লিখুন, কিন্তু আমি একটি ডাটাবেস লোক প্রথম এবং সর্বাগ্রে, তাই এটি সাধারণত অন্য যে কোন ভাষার তুলনায় আমাকে ভাল মামলা। কিন্তু প্রচুর জিনিস আছে যে এটি খুব ভাল করে না, কোন ক্ষেত্রে যেমন plperl বা plapethon একটি ভাল বাজি হয় অবশ্যই, যদি গতি একটি গুরুতর উদ্বেগের বিষয় হয়, সি যেতে যেতে উপায়।

0
যোগ
হ্যাঁ, আমি কিছু জন্য পিএল / পিথন ব্যবহার শুরু করেছি এবং নিরাপত্তা উদ্বেগ সম্পর্কে পড়া এবং তারপর plpgsql উপর তাকিয়ে দেখেছি এবং এটি সবকিছু আমি সহজভাবে চাই চাই। আমি এটা পছন্দ করি.
যোগ লেখক Arthur Thomas, উৎস

পিএল / রুবি কারণ আমি প্রতিদিন রুবি ব্যবহার করি।

0
যোগ
একটি পিএল / রুবি ব্যবহারকারী হিসাবে, আমার প্রশ্নে আপনার কোনও ধারণা থাকতে পারে stackoverflow.com/questions/617600/… ? - ধন্যবাদ
যোগ লেখক Mike Berrow, উৎস

আমি পিএল / পার্ল ব্যবহার করি কারণ:

  • I like Perl
  • It's a dynamic language, which means that you can do some useful tricks easy, i.e. passing a column name to a trigger function and doing some actions with the value of this column in a trigger tuple.
  • It has a pretty good documentation
0
যোগ